Nalgonda: District Collector Prashant Jeevan Patil on Wednesday said farmers need not worry as the paddy purchasing exercise would continue till the last grain is procured.
Speaking at a meeting held with millers here, Patil said farmers should cooperate with the staff at the procurement centers by bringing paddy with low moisture content. “This would also enable farmers to get a good price for their crop,” he said, and instructed the millers to unload the paddy from lorries that had queued up at their mills.
The officials of agriculture department and staff at paddy purchasing centres should issue tokens to farmers to ensure systematic procedure in weighing and purchase of paddy, he said.
Stating that the paddy procurement centres will continue till June end, he suggested farmers not to rush with their paddy produce to the procurement centres in groups to avoid overcrowding.
Additional Joint Collector (Revenue) V Chandrasekhar, District Manager of Civil Supplies Nageshwar Rao and Rice Milers Association district president Yadagiri also attended the meeting.
